Re: Oi, tires!
I got a harbor freight motorcycle changer tire about 100 bucks. I use the Cheng Shen tires. Changing tires is not all that difficult and if you do alot of miles it makes a lot of sense. The Dunlops have steel belts in them witch can make them tough to do with spoons ( I wrecked one thats why I bought the Harbor freight changer.)
http://www.harborfreight.com/cpi/ctaf/d ... mber=34542 http://www.harborfreight.com/cpi/ctaf/D ... mber=42927 The price has risen but sometimes the only way to get it done right is to do it yourself. Balance is done using the steel stock and a couple of buckets. The big advantage with the GZ is that it uses tubes and thus you can do it without a compressor.
